PM Cares helped triple number of ventilators – 16,000 to 60,000+
Ventilators allocated to states and Union Territories under PM Care and Health Ministry have more than tripled availability of the critical care machines in public hospitals from around 16,000 when the Covid-19 pandemic struck last year to nearly at 60000 presentRead more at: http://timesofindia.indiatimes.com/articleshow/82695564.cms?utm_source=contentofinterest&utm_medium=text&utm_campaign=cppst . DRDO Develops Covid-19 Antibody Detection Kit “DIPCOVAN”
Defence Institute of Physiology and Allied Sciences (DIPAS), DRDO has developed an antibody detection-based kit “DIPCOVAN”, the DIPAS-VDx COVID 19 IgG Antibody Microwell ELISA for sero-surveillance.
